Simplicity Of Modern Haiku Poem by Joyce Hemsley

Simplicity Of Modern Haiku



Many a pretty poem I have written
with flowery words and explanations
but on reflection ~ yes, it is true
the words could be condensed into
'simple haiku'...
three lines of rhyme or non-rhyme.
subject matter, anything goes!
A most popular theme is 'the rose'.

In warm sunny air
blooms a sweet rose of Tralee
so lovely and fair.

One of life's miracles...
just seventeen syllables.
